HBO Max confirmed the return of "Friends": the fortune that the protagonists would charge

Jennifer Aniston and company will meet again for a special that will be broadcast on the future content platform.

After several weeks of speculation, the future content platform HBO Max confirmed on Friday that the main stars of the "Friends" series will meet again in a special that will be available from the launch of the service next May.

The six protagonists of the sitcom, their creators and the Warner Bros studios. they reached an agreement to prepare this special together after several negotiations, according to sources cited by the specialized media The Hollywood Reporter.

Jennifer Aniston, Courteney Cox , Lisa Kudrow , Matt LeBlanc , Matthew Perry and David Schwimmer , as well as the creators David Crane and Marta Kauffman, would have asked for this program twice the salary they charged for each episode of the mythical series, an amount that US media estimate that it will be around 2.5 or 3 million dollars.

Some interpreters of the series, such as Perry and Aniston, confirmed the meeting on their Instagram profiles.

Although the millions of "Friends" fans have sighed for years for new episodes of the series, this special meeting would not be an episode of fiction as such but, rather, a "retrospective" style show with interviews with the cast.

The special will be filmed in studio 24 of the Warner Bros headquarters in Burbank, California, the same place where the original series was recorded.

This program will be the cover letter for HBO Max, the new "streaming" service of WarnerMedia and will have the broadcasting rights of "Friends" after leaving Netflix .

It will be a strong premiere for the platform, just as Disney + opted for the Star Wars universe with "The Mandalorian" for its landing.

Until now, "Friends" was broadcast on Netflix, but Warner did not hesitate to disburse more than 400 million dollars this summer to recover it and integrate it as one of the diamonds of his future HBO Max service.

"Friends", which premiered on September 22, 1994, closed in 2004 ten seasons of success after 236 episodes on the air starring Aniston, Cox, Kudrow, LeBlanc, Perry and Schwimmer.

But comedy is still a phenomenon for countless fans around the world who are still willing to watch, again and again on repositions or digital platforms, the New York stories of Rachel, Monica, Phoebe, Joey, Chandler and Ross.
